Game Server Technical Lead
hace 2 semanas
Senior Server Architect Position
This is a pivotal role in shaping the future of our MMO game server architecture. We are looking for an experienced Senior Server Engineer to join our team and design, develop, and maintain backend services and APIs in Python running on AWS.
The successful candidate will work in a team responsible for designing, developing, and maintaining backend services and APIs in Python running on AWS. They will also plan the future of our server core technologies that will lay the foundation for exciting new gameplay features.
Main Responsibilities:
- Design, develop, and maintain high-availability back-end systems and servers for large-scale MMO games, high-traffic web systems or applications
- Develop and implement new features in our core technologies, working collaboratively with other stakeholder teams to understand requirements and identify the best technical solutions
- Inspect the performance of our server clusters and propose improvements
- Deep analysis of player behaviors and how our server can be hardened to both improve player experience and also defend against bad actors (botters, cheaters, etc)
- Work closely with the QA team to resolve bugs and deliver high-quality code
- Deploy, monitor, and manage applications in a cloud environment such as AWS
Requirements:
- Highly experienced in developing highly available back-end systems and servers for large-scale MMO games, high-traffic web systems or applications
- Experienced with Python and its ecosystem (libraries, frameworks, etc.), familiarity with web frameworks such as Flask, Tornado, FastAPI, or another similar web framework and Python threading, as well as the principles of async programming
- Familiarity with the design and implementation of highly scalable, reliable, and secure systems using Redis and its ecosystem, as well as solid understanding of RESTful API design and development
- Strong knowledge of Linux operating systems and Docker containers, as well as Redis, MySQL (or similar database systems)
- Good understanding of how to prevent intrusions, injections, cheating, etc.
- Experience in version control, especially multi-track development and familiarity with deployment methodologies and CI / CD pipelines
- Experience with automated testing
Bonus Points:
- Familiarity with messaging systems such as RabbitMQ, AWS SQS, Redis Streams
- Experience working with AWS services like EC2, ECR, RDS, S3, and IAM
- Knowledge of Infrastructure-as-Code (IaC) and experience with Terraform for managing infrastructure deployment
- Understanding of network infrastructure and cloud networking concepts, such as VPC, Subnet, Security Groups, and Load Balancing
About the Role:
We are committed to creating a diverse, supportive work environment where everyone is treated with respect. We are committed to providing equal employment opportunities and welcome individuals from all backgrounds to join us.
About Us:
We create games for everyone - and want to ensure that the people behind our games reflect that. Our global interactive entertainment company is home to many top, award-winning experiences.
We recognize multiple times as one of Fast Company's
-
Tech Team Lead
hace 3 semanas
Oviedo, Asturias, España Scopely A tiempo completoTech Team Lead (Server) - Unannounced Project ES - Spain; GB - United Kingdom; IE - Ireland; PT - Portugal Scopely is looking for a Technical Team Lead to join our new unannounced project in either Ireland, Spain, Portugal or the UK on a hybrid / remote basis. We can support with visa sponsorship and relocation assistance. At Scopely, we care deeply about...
-
Tech Team Lead
hace 3 semanas
Oviedo, Asturias, España Scopely A tiempo completoTech Team Lead (Server) - Unannounced ProjectES - Spain; GB - United Kingdom; IE - Ireland; PT - PortugalScopely is looking for a Technical Team Lead to join our new unannounced project in either Ireland, Spain, Portugal or the UK on a hybrid / remote basis. We can support with visa sponsorship and relocation assistance.At Scopely, we care deeply about what...
-
Senior Server
hace 7 días
Oviedo, Asturias, España Permhunt A tiempo completoAbout the job Senior Server & Cloud EngineerAbout the RoleOur client is looking for an experienced and proactive Senior Server and Cloud Engineer to join their Engineering and Implementation team.In this role, youll take the lead in designing, deploying, and maintaining on-premises and cloud-hosted systemsensuring security, reliability, and performance...
-
Game Designer
hace 6 días
Oviedo, Asturias, España buscojobs España A tiempo completoCrazyLabs, a world-leading mobile game developer with over 7 billion downloads to date, is looking for an experienced and creative Game Designer to work on a new industry-leading Hybrid Casual game. Our ideal candidate should be a gamer with previous experience creating and maintaining successful and fun mobile games Description : Design new systems,...
-
Game Development Director
hace 2 días
Oviedo, Asturias, España beBeeGame A tiempo completoImagine developing world leading casual games for millions of players worldwide, on the go.We're looking for an experienced Game Development Director to deliver exceptional game experiences. Your role would be to create entertainment for a vast audience by working with a team of developers and artists. You will be responsible for transforming great game...
-
Mobile Game Experience Leader
hace 4 días
Oviedo, Asturias, España beBeeDesigner A tiempo completoGame Design Expert WantedWe're seeking a highly skilled Game Designer to join our team and contribute to the development of a new Hybrid Casual game. Our ideal candidate should have a proven track record in creating engaging mobile games and possess excellent communication skills.Responsibilities:Design new systems, features, and game mechanicsBalance and...
-
Technical Product Lead
hace 4 días
Oviedo, Asturias, España beBeeProduct A tiempo completoTechnical Product Lead - CMS ExpertiseWe are seeking a seasoned professional to lead our projects and deliver innovative solutions.About the Role:Maximize customer value through product management.Define and execute product strategies that drive business growth.This is an opportunity to leverage your technical expertise in CMS to make a significant impact on...
-
Technical Lead
hace 2 semanas
Oviedo, Asturias, España beBeeQuality A tiempo completoSenior Quality Assurance LeadThis is a challenging dual role, as a Quality Assurance Lead and Technical Expert.The Technical Expert will leverage their deep and broad technical expertise to identify and implement relevant technology solutions and tools that will accelerate product delivery. They will contribute to squads as a member, where the success of the...
-
Technical Lead for Web Application Development
hace 6 días
Oviedo, Asturias, España beBeeTechnical A tiempo completoJob Title: Technical Lead for Web Application DevelopmentA challenging and rewarding opportunity exists for a highly skilled technical professional to lead the development of modern web-based applications. As a key member of our team, you will be responsible for designing, developing, testing, and deploying innovative solutions that meet the needs of our...
-
Java Technical Lead
hace 4 semanas
Oviedo, Asturias, España Knowmad Mood A tiempo completoatSistemas ni cambia ni se transforma, evoluciona a knowmad mood Si en tus propósitos de año tienes apuntado el poder crecer profesionalmente liderando técnicamente proyectos punteros y participando en entornos laborales donde la colaboración, la innovación y la diversión cobran protagonismo... en knowmad mood podrás hacer check En esta oportunidad...